How We Rank Schools

Every school list on this site is ordered by the BOC Score, computed from the most recent school-level data published by the U.S. Department of Education (College Scorecard and IPEDS). To qualify, a school must be currently operating and accredited by an agency recognized by the U.S. Department of Education. Each eligible school is then scored on five measures, percentile-ranked against schools at the same credential level:

  • Graduation rate 30%
  • Median earnings, 10 years after entry 25%
  • Average net price (lower is better) 20%
  • Retention rate 15%
  • Fully online availability 10%

Schools without enough outcome data appear after ranked schools, without a score. On this page, schools are ordered by distance from Thousand Oaks. Advertising never affects these rankings. Read the full methodology.

Social Work Wages Near Thousand Oaks

Thousand Oaks is part of the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A metro area (BLS area code 37100). Where MSA-level wages are published, the table below shows MSA medians; otherwise it falls back to California statewide.

OccupationMedian WageSourceCOL-Adjusted (US=100)
Child, Family, and School Social Worker$75,580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$68,398
Healthcare Social Worker$87,570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$79,249
Mental Health and Substance Abuse Social Worker$64,990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$58,814
Social Worker, All Other$79,260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$71,729
Social and Community Service Manager$80,840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$73,158
Social and Human Service Assistant$52,180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$47,222
Community Health Worker$52,770Oxnard-Thousand Oaks-Ventura, CA$47,756

Source: BLS, May 2025 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.
